  • The pathway from Water Lane to Church Bridge has been damaged due to natural wear and tear and also more significantly through the floods in September and November 2024. The stream banks are eroding and this causes potential problems for pedestrians with wheelchairs or families with double buggies, as well as restricting the access for the houses on that section. The banks need shearing up significantly. Thank you.
